Summary: The lawmakers noted that NECO had allegedly been implementing virement by reallocating funds within its budget without the required legislative approval.
The House of Representatives has mandated its Committee on Basic Education and Examination Bodies to investigate the budget implementation, Internally Generated Revenues (IGRs), and alleged unauthorised virements by the National Examination Council (NECO) between 2023 and 2025.
